centos

centos如何备份filesystem

小樊
31
2025-11-27 17:07:55
栏目: 智能运维

在CentOS系统中,备份文件系统可以通过多种方法实现,以下是一些常用的方法:

1. 使用 rsync 命令

rsync 是一个非常强大的文件同步工具,可以用来备份整个文件系统。

sudo rsync -aAXv --exclude={"/dev/*","/proc/*","/sys/*","/tmp/*","/run/*","/mnt/*","/media/*","/lost+found"} / /path/to/backup

2. 使用 tar 命令

tar 是一个常用的打包工具,可以用来创建文件系统的压缩备份。

sudo tar -cvpzf /path/to/backup.tar.gz --exclude={"/dev/*","/proc/*","/sys/*","/tmp/*","/run/*","/mnt/*","/media/*","/lost+found"} /

3. 使用 dumprestore 命令

dumprestore 是传统的备份工具,适用于整个文件系统的备份和恢复。

备份

sudo dump -0uj -f /path/to/backup.dump /

恢复

sudo restore -rf /path/to/backup.dump

4. 使用 rsnapshot

rsnapshot 是一个基于 rsync 的备份工具,可以方便地进行增量备份和时间点恢复。

首先,安装 rsnapshot

sudo yum install rsnapshot

然后,编辑配置文件 /etc/rsnapshot.conf,根据需要进行配置。

最后,运行备份命令:

sudo rsnapshot hourly

rsnapshot 会按照配置文件中的时间间隔(如每小时、每天等)进行增量备份。

注意事项

通过以上方法,你可以有效地备份CentOS系统的文件系统。

0
看了该问题的人还看了